Introduction

Oceanography is the study of the ocean, its currents, ecosystems, and marine life. It is a fascinating field that combines aspects of biology, chemistry, physics, and geology.

Exploring the Depths

Scientists use various tools such as sonar, satellites, and underwater drones to explore the depths of the ocean. They study the ocean’s topography, temperature, and salinity to better understand how it affects marine life.

The Importance of Oceanography

Oceanography plays a crucial role in predicting weather patterns, monitoring climate change, and managing fisheries. It helps us understand the impact of human activities on the ocean and how we can protect this precious resource.
